Project Accounting/Invoicing Support Consultant

Job Description

Our client's Project Accounting team recently went live on a new ERP system and is in the final stages of completing month‑end close while ramping up for the first invoicing cycle. Due to high volume and incomplete migration of historical backup files, the team is seeking temporary administrative resources to support invoicing preparation, backup support, and documentation.

This role is critical to ensuring accurate, timely invoicing by pulling timesheet and expense backup from legacy systems, organizing supporting documentation, and assisting with client‑specific invoice requirements. The team is currently overwhelmed, and speed of onboarding is a top priority.

Key Responsibilities

  • Retrieve timesheet and expense backup documentation from the legacy system
  • Support the first invoicing cycle by organizing and validating supporting documentation
  • Pull detailed hour data as needed, export to Excel, and create pivot tables for attachment to invoices
  • Assist with the creation and standardization of invoicing templates
  • Support client‑specific invoicing requirements (some long‑tenured clients require invoices in specific formats)
  • Merge documents, manage PDFs, and ensure all backup is complete and audit‑ready
  • Follow documented procedures and step‑by‑step instructions accurately in a high‑volume environment

Additional Skills &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ree in Accounting, Finance, or a related field
  • Experience supporting invoicing or billing processes (administrative or project accounting support level)
  • Experience utilizing ERP accounting software
  • Heavy use of Excel, PDFs, and legacy system data pulls
  • Strong attention to detail with the ability to follow written procedures accurately
  • Strong Excel proficiency, including: Pivot tables, Grouping and sorting data, Subtotaling, & VLOOKUP
  • Comfortable working with PDFs and Adobe tools
  • Ability to perform repetitive, manual tasks with a high level of accuracy
  • Strong organizational and documentation skills
  • Ability to ramp up quickly with minimal training

Work Environment

  • This position is remote, operating on EST hours from 8 AM to 5 PM. Candidates must have their own laptop/computer to authenticate via two-factor authentication, with Oracle Cloud machine access provided. Priority will be given to candidates with their own equipment to facilitate faster start times.
